Abstract
Climate change studies in recent decades have been based on Global Climate Models (GCMs), and the changes in the distribution of climatic regions over time extracted from these models can be represented using the Koppen climatic classification system, which predicts the global distribution of biomes based on monthly precipitation and average temperatures.
